10 #ifndef __OSSL_SHA_H__
11 #define	__OSSL_SHA_H__
12 
13 /*
14  * This is always included last which permits the namespace hacks below
15  * to work.
16  */
17 #define	SHA256_CTX	OSSL_SHA256_CTX
18 #define	SHA512_CTX	OSSL_SHA512_CTX
19 
20 /* From include/openssl/sha.h */
21 # define SHA_LONG unsigned int
22 
23 # define SHA_LBLOCK      16
24 # define SHA_CBLOCK      (SHA_LBLOCK*4)/* SHA treats input data as a
25                                         * contiguous array of 32 bit wide
26                                         * big-endian values. */
27 
28 typedef struct SHAstate_st {
29     SHA_LONG h0, h1, h2, h3, h4;
30     SHA_LONG Nl, Nh;
31     SHA_LONG data[SHA_LBLOCK];
32     unsigned int num;
33 } SHA_CTX;
34 
35 # define SHA256_CBLOCK   (SHA_LBLOCK*4)/* SHA-256 treats input data as a
36                                         * contiguous array of 32 bit wide
37                                         * big-endian values. */
38 
39 typedef struct SHA256state_st {
40     SHA_LONG h[8];
41     SHA_LONG Nl, Nh;
42     SHA_LONG data[SHA_LBLOCK];
43     unsigned int num, md_len;
44 } SHA256_CTX;
45 
46 /*
47  * SHA-512 treats input data as a
48  * contiguous array of 64 bit
49  * wide big-endian values.
50  */
51 # define SHA512_CBLOCK   (SHA_LBLOCK*8)
52 
53 #  define SHA_LONG64 unsigned long long
54 #  define U64(C)     C##ULL
55 
56 typedef struct SHA512state_st {
57     SHA_LONG64 h[8];
58     SHA_LONG64 Nl, Nh;
59     union {
60         SHA_LONG64 d[SHA_LBLOCK];
61         unsigned char p[SHA512_CBLOCK];
62     } u;
63     unsigned int num, md_len;
64 } SHA512_CTX;
65 
66 #endif /* !__OSSL_SHA_H__ */
